The $18,000 Testing Methodology
To make this fair, I controlled every variable possible:
Same Target Market
- B2B SaaS companies ($1M-50M revenue)
- VP Sales, CMO, CEO titles
- 50-500 employees
- Tech-forward industries
Same Offer
- "Book a free cold email audit - we'll show you how to get 40-100 leads/month"
- Same landing page for all channels
- Same follow-up sequence
- Same sales process after booking
Budget Allocation (6 months)
- Cold email: $3,000 total
- Google Ads: $5,000 total
- Facebook Ads: $5,000 total
- LinkedIn Ads: $5,000 total
Total budget: $18,000 over 6 months
Complete Results: The Winner Is...
| Metric | Cold Email | Google Ads | Facebook Ads | LinkedIn Ads |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Total Spend | $3,000 | $5,000 | $5,000 | $5,000 |
| Leads Generated | 487 | 312 | 584 | 127 |
| Cost Per Lead | $6.16 | $16.03 | $8.56 | $39.37 |
| Meetings Booked | 142 | 87 | 71 | 34 |
| Cost Per Meeting | $21.13 | $57.47 | $70.42 | $147.06 |
| Show Rate | 71% | 84% | 62% | 88% |
| Customers Closed | 47 | 31 | 18 | 12 |
| CAC | $63.83 | $161.29 | $277.78 | $416.67 |
| Avg Deal Size | $5,200 | $6,800 | $4,100 | $8,300 |
| Revenue Generated | $244,400 | $210,800 | $73,800 | $99,600 |
| ROI | 82x | 42x | 15x | 20x |
Winner: Cold Email (82x ROI vs 11x average for paid ads)
Key findings:
- Cold email generated 2.6x more customers at 1/3 the budget
- LinkedIn Ads had highest quality leads but lowest volume
- Google Ads had best show rates (84%)
- Facebook Ads underperformed across all metrics
Why Cold Email Crushed Paid Ads
After analyzing 6 months of data, here's why cold email outperformed:
1. Direct Targeting
Cold email: I could target exactly who I wanted. VP of Sales at Series B SaaS company with 50-200 employees? Easy.
Paid ads: Limited targeting precision. Even LinkedIn Ads (best targeting) couldn't match the specificity of cold email.
Result: 38% higher lead quality from cold email.
2. Cost Structure
Cold email costs:
- Infrastructure: $500/month (domains, warmup, tools)
- Total 6 months: $3,000
- Reached 8,200 prospects
Paid ads costs:
- Average CPC: $8.50 (LinkedIn), $4.20 (Google), $2.80 (Facebook)
- Had to pay for EVERY click, even unqualified
- 47% of clicks were bot traffic or irrelevant

3. Message Personalization
Cold email: Used AI personalization for every email. Referenced specific company info, recent news, hiring patterns.
Paid ads: Generic messaging. Can't personalize ads for each viewer at scale.
Result: 14.2% reply rate on cold email vs 3.8% conversion on paid ads.
4. No Platform Fees
With cold email, I kept 100% of my budget. With paid ads:
- Google takes their cut (auction fees)
- Facebook takes their cut
- LinkedIn takes their cut (highest CPM)
Effectively paying 20-40% premium for ad platform access.

When Paid Ads Beat Cold Email
Paid ads aren't terrible. They won in specific scenarios:
Scenario 1: Brand Awareness
If you need 10,000+ people to SEE your brand (not necessarily convert), paid ads win.
Impressions:
- Paid ads: 847,000 impressions
- Cold email: 8,200 reached
For top-of-funnel awareness, ads are better.
Scenario 2: Consumer Products
My test was B2B SaaS. For consumer products (e-commerce, mobile apps, DTC), Facebook/Google Ads often win.
Cold email doesn't work well for B2C.
Scenario 3: Retargeting
Retargeting people who visited your site? Paid ads are excellent.
I got 23% conversion rate on LinkedIn retargeting (vs 12% on cold email follow-ups).
Scenario 4: High-Intent Search Terms
If someone searches "cold email automation tool," Google Ads can capture that intent immediately.
Cold email can't capture search intent.
Cost Breakdown: Where Money Goes
Cold Email Costs ($3,000 over 6 months)
| Item | Monthly Cost | 6-Month Total |
|---|---|---|
| Instantly.ai (sending) | $97 | $582 |
| Domains (15 domains) | $35 | $210 |
| Google Workspace | $90 | $540 |
| Apollo (data) | $79 | $474 |
| Claude API (AI writing) | $65 | $390 |
| Warmup tools | $49 | $294 |
| Time (10 hrs/month @ $50/hr) | $85 | $510 |
| Total | $500 | $3,000 |
Paid Ads Costs ($15,000 over 6 months)
| Platform | Ad Spend | Management | Creative | Total |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Google Ads | $4,000 | $800 | $200 | $5,000 |
| Facebook Ads | $4,200 | $600 | $200 | $5,000 |
| LinkedIn Ads | $4,000 | $700 | $300 | $5,000 |
| Total | $12,200 | $2,100 | $700 | $15,000 |
Cold email was 5x cheaper for the same 6-month period.

Google Ads Performance
What worked:
- Search intent capture ("cold email automation" etc.)
- Highest show rate (84%)
- Best retargeting performance
What didn't work:
- High CPC ($4.20 average)
- 45% bot/invalid traffic
- Long sales cycle (avg 47 days)
Best use case: Capturing high-intent searches, retargeting
Facebook Ads Performance
What worked:
- Lowest CPC ($2.80)
- Good for top-of-funnel awareness
- Decent creative testing platform
What didn't work:
- Poor B2B targeting
- Low-quality leads (62% show rate)
- Lowest deal sizes ($4,100 avg)
Best use case: B2C products, brand awareness campaigns
LinkedIn Ads Performance
What worked:
- Best targeting (job title, company size, seniority)
- Highest quality leads (88% show rate)
- Largest deal sizes ($8,300 avg)
What didn't work:
- Highest CPC ($8.50)
- Lowest volume (127 leads total)
- Most expensive CAC ($416.67)
Best use case: Enterprise deals over $20K, when volume isn't critical
Cold Email Performance
What worked:
- Best ROI (82x)
- Lowest CAC ($63.83)
- Highest volume (487 leads)
- Complete control over targeting
- Scalable (AI agents can automate)
What didn't work:
- Slower ramp-up (need proper deliverability setup)
- Requires technical knowledge
- No brand awareness value
Best use case: B2B lead generation, predictable pipeline, ROI-focused growth

Common Mistakes to Avoid
Mistake 1: Comparing CPM Instead of CAC
Don't optimize for cost per click. Optimize for cost per CUSTOMER.
Facebook had lowest CPC ($2.80) but highest CAC ($277.78). Doesn't matter.
Mistake 2: Ignoring LTV
LinkedIn had highest CAC ($416.67) but also highest deal size ($8,300) and best retention.
LTV:CAC ratio: - Cold email: 81:1 - LinkedIn Ads: 20:1 - Google Ads: 42:1 - Facebook Ads: 15:1
All profitable, just different efficiency.
Mistake 3: Not Testing Long Enough
First month results were misleading:
- Month 1: Paid ads won (faster setup)
- Month 3: Cold email caught up
- Month 6: Cold email dominated
Test for at least 90 days.
Mistake 4: Bad Cold Email Setup
Most people fail at cold email because of poor infrastructure:
- No domain warmup = spam folder
- Poor targeting = low reply rates
- Generic emails = ignored
Do it right or don't do it at all.
Which Channel Should You Choose?
Choose Cold Email If:
- You're B2B (especially SaaS, agencies, consulting)
- Budget under $10K/month
- You want predictable pipeline
- ROI is your primary metric
- You have time to set up properly (2-4 weeks)
- Target market is well-defined
Choose Paid Ads If:
- You need immediate results (ads can start day 1)
- Brand awareness matters
- You're B2C or marketplace
- Budget over $20K/month (enough to test properly)
- You have proven product-market fit
- High-intent search terms exist
Use Both (Hybrid) If:
- Budget allows ($5K+/month)
- You want maximum reach
- Deal sizes over $15K (justifies multi-channel)
- Long sales cycles (90+ days)
